May 13, 2024 · In 2024 there has been an uptick in sleeper train services in Europe, with new overnight routes from Paris to Berlin and Vienna to Hamburg on ÖBB's Nightjet. There’s also a European sleeper night train connecting London to Prague via Eurostar. It’s a good way to travel in comfort and with a view.
Eurostar trains in the renovated train shed at London St Pancras International Eurostar's fares were significantly higher in its early years; the cheapest fare in 1994 was £99 return. [ 76 ] In 2002, Eurostar was planning cheaper fares, an example of which was an offer of £50-day returns from London to Paris or Brussels.
Dec 17, 2017 · Eurostar’s London to Lille service is the shortest trip offered by Eurostar, taking just 1 hour and 22 minutes. With nearly 20 daily journeys, Lille allows commuters and travellers alike to travel between France and the UK with ease. This ever-popular route has been available since Eurostar was first founded in 1994.

Fares from London to Paris or Brussels start at £52 one-way or £78 return. Standard Premier (1st class) fares start at £115 one-way, £199 return. Fares work like air fares. Prices increase as departure date approaches and cheaper tickets sell out, so book early.
